About the Album

Returning to Drown Myself, Finally is the sixth track from trumpeter/composer Nate Wooley’s latest album, Ancient Songs of Burlap Heroes. With the self-titled 2019 debut of his remarkable quartet Columbia Icefield, trumpeter/composer Wooley traced the Columbia River from his Oregon hometown to its glacial headwaters, sonically reckoning with the awe-inspiring beauty of the immense icefield. The band’s breathtaking follow-up, Ancient Songs of Burlap Heroes, essentially brings the project full circle, a thematic homecoming that contrasts the intimacy of one’s roots with the vastness of the wider world.
